1. Sit where the host tells you to, or you may ask.
2. Wait for others to start eating. Many families will pray first. If you are not a Christian, just keep silent
and wait.
3. Try a little of everything___do not take a lot of anything,(A formal setting for western meals)
4. If you do not want something, just pass it on. You do not need to say anything. If they ask, you may
say, "Looks good, but I think I won't have any, Thank you."
5. Keep the table and table-cloth as clean as possible. Do not put bones or anything else on the table.
Things that are not eaten up should be put on your plate.
6. Don't forget "please" and "thank you." These are handy(得心應(yīng)手的) words in most situations but
especially important at the table where common courtesies are noticed by everyone present.

What’s the coolest kind of transportation(交通) for middle school students back from winter holidays? A racing bike? A car? No, it’s a special kind of shoes called Heelys(暴走鞋). Heelys look just like common sports shoes, but they have a wheel(輪子) hidden(藏) in the heel(鞋跟). So instead of walking, kids can “fly” around in them.

“Wearing Heelys is fun and cool!” said Wu Peng, a boy who wore them on his first day back at No. 6 Middle School in Beijing. Wu Peng said he loves the shoes so much that he wears them to go here and there. Sometimes he even follows his parents’ car to the supermarket in his Heelys!

Other students also think they are very cool, but some aren’t so lucky with their Heelys. It’s said that some children fell down and got hurt while wearing these shoes.

“Heelys wheels are in the heels of the shoes, so it’s easy to fall,” said Liu Rui, a doctor at the Hong Kong International Medical Clinic, Beijing. Even worse, Liu said, “Wearing Heelys for a long time could stop young people from developing their legs. ”

It's sometimes reported that strange objects have been seen high up in the sky. These unidentified(未確認的) flying objects - UFOs have made a lot of people interested. Some of the reports about them are difficult to believe.Some have been explained in scientific ways, others have never been explained.

  It is not easy to decide whether a report is true or not. One report of UFOs came from a British plane on its way from New York to London in 1954. The British plane was flying over an island at 19,000 feet when the captain noticed that something was on their left and a little lower than their plane. It's about five miles away.

  "It was not one object but several," the captain said. "We saw one large and six smaller objects. I sent a radio to report about them and I received the answer that the other planes were coming out to meet us. Before the planes arrived, the smaller objects entered the big objects. The big object then became smaller and moved away fast."
